Mylena Freitas joins FC Porto women's team after Brooklyn spell

Article image:Mylena Freitas joins FC Porto women's team after Brooklyn spell

FC Porto unveiled on Friday Brazilian forward Mylena Freitas as a signing for their women's team, who will compete in the top flight. The 25-year-old arrives from Brooklyn FC in the United States.

She returns to Portugal after spells with Braga and Famalicão and has a Taça de Portugal on her CV. She spoke to the club's official channels about the move.


OneFootball Videos


Freitas said she was happy and excited and hopes for a season filled with smiles. She already feels at home in Portugal and was very happy when Porto's offer arrived.

She stressed the need to keep feet on the ground and accepted that what will be will be. She described herself as very competitive, while also having a Brazilian, more playful side.

Freitas added that when on the pitch they must give their best at all times.
